Deck sealing services involve applying specialized sealants to the surface of a deck to protect it from moisture, UV rays, and other environmental factors. The process typically includes cleaning the deck thoroughly to remove dirt, mold, and old coatings, followed by the application of a protective sealant that penetrates the wood or composite material. This treatment helps to create a barrier that minimizes water infiltration and reduces the risk of damage caused by weather exposure, extending the lifespan of the deck and maintaining its appearance over time.

One of the primary issues deck sealing addresses is water damage. Without proper protection, decks are vulnerable to rot, warping, and splitting due to moisture absorption. Sealants help prevent water from seeping into the wood, which can lead to costly repairs and structural concerns. Additionally, deck sealing can inhibit the growth of mold and mildew, which thrive in damp environments and can cause staining and deterioration. By reducing these problems, sealing services contribute to preserving the integrity and aesthetic appeal of outdoor decks.

The overview below groups typical Deck Sealing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Loveland, CO.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Basic Sealant Application - The cost for sealing a standard deck typically ranges from $300 to $700, depending on the size and condition of the surface. Smaller decks may be on the lower end, while larger or more complex projects can increase expenses.

Premium Sealant Services - Higher-end sealant options with advanced protection features usually cost between $800 and $1,500. These services often include additional surface preparation and longer-lasting sealants.

Additional Preparation Costs - Surface cleaning, repairs, or sanding prior to sealing can add $100 to $400 to the overall project. These steps ensure optimal adhesion and durability of the sealant applied by local service providers.

Travel and Accessibility Fees - If the deck is difficult to access or requires special equipment, service providers may charge extra, typically ranging from $50 to $200. Such fees vary based on location and project complexity.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is deck sealing? Deck sealing involves applying a protective coating to a deck's surface to help prevent damage from moisture, UV rays, and wear over time.

How often should a deck be sealed? The frequency of sealing depends on the type of sealant used and local weather conditions, but generally, decks should be resealed every one to three years.

What types of sealants are used for decks? Common sealants include penetrating sealers, acrylics, and polyurethane coatings, each offering different levels of protection and appearance.

Can deck sealing be done on any type of deck? Most decks made of wood or composite materials can be sealed, but it's best to consult with a local professional to determine the suitable products for specific materials.

Why hire a professional for deck sealing? Professional contractors have the expertise to properly prepare and apply sealants, ensuring effective protection and a long-lasting finish.
